If you love nature, want to support your wellbeing and feel a valued part of a community – our monthly Wild Women is for you!

Wild Women is a community built by you and for you. It will be shaped by what serves the group and will provide a safe space for you to give and receive what you need.

Each month there will be a mixture of nature and wellbeing activities based in the Hive grounds and Epping Forest. For example:

  • Gather around the campfire for a cuppa and a chat
  • Share simple crafts and learn new skills
  • Explore mindfulness practices and find what works for you
  • Look after your body with gentle exercises or walks in the woods
  • Bookclub discussions
  • Community cooking (and eating!)
  • *Support for moving through menopause more smoothly

Sessions will be facilitated by our qualified Wilderness Therapeutic Practitioner, who is passionate about bringing the benefits of nature to all ages. While this is not therapy, you will be well supported.

*The group is for all women at all stages, but we recognise that some periods of life can be more challenging than others. We particularly encourage those moving through menopause or other stressful times. Activities will be specially chosen to empower, inspire and nurture you.
